When I felt tired all the time I barely wanted to get out of bed. I would wake up late for work after pushing the snooze button on my alarm clock multiple times and I really had no motivation to get me through the day. Work turned into a constant game of catchup as every day I would feel like I was dragging and couldn’t do anything to stop it. At that time though I made a decision that I would not let my life get any worse as a result of my tiredness and I began to look for ways to get out of the downward spiral I had got myself in to.

The first place that I started looking was my caffeine intake, I was taking in at the time about 4 - 6 coffees per day. I know it sounds like quite a lot but when you find yourself as tired as I was I felt like I had no choice. What I didn’t realize when I was drinking the coffee though is that it was impacting quite negatively on my day and was a contributor to my feelings of tiredness all the time. Coffee is a substance that dehydrates you once drinking it so you need to take in water while you drink coffee. I didn’t know this and for a number of weeks was probably drinking as much coffee as I did water. Immediately when I made this discovery I began to drink more water and found myself feeling much better after it. I remember the telling sign for me that I was not drinking enough water also was that I felt really quite bloated.
